Introduction: Investment Comparison Between REZ and BNB

In the cryptocurrency market, the comparison between REZ and BNB remains a topic that investors cannot bypass. The two differ significantly in market cap ranking, application scenarios, and price performance, representing distinct positioning within the crypto asset landscape.

REZ (Renzo): Launched in April 2024, it has gained market recognition through its positioning as a Liquid Restaking Token (LRT) and Strategy Manager for EigenLayer, offering higher yields than traditional ETH staking.

BNB (Binance Coin): Since its launch in July 2017, it has been recognized as the native utility token of the Binance ecosystem, serving as one of the cryptocurrencies with substantial global trading volume and market capitalization.

I. Price History Comparison and Current Market Status

  • 2024: REZ reached a peak price of 0.265 USDT on April 30, 2024, following its initial listing and launch in the EigenLayer ecosystem.
  • 2025: REZ experienced significant downward pressure, declining to an all-time low of 0.004148 USDT on December 18, 2025.
  • Historical comparison: BNB demonstrated more stable long-term performance, with its all-time high of 1369.99 USDT recorded on October 13, 2025, while maintaining a price above 878 USDT as of January 2026. In contrast, REZ has declined approximately 98.4% from its historical peak.

Current Market Status (January 23, 2026)

  • REZ current price: 0.004586 USDT
  • BNB current price: 888.3 USDT
  • 24-hour trading volume: REZ recorded 68,697.07 USDT versus BNB's 5,870,940.66 USDT
  • Market sentiment index (Fear & Greed Index): 20 (Extreme Fear)

Q4: What are the primary technological and ecosystem differences between REZ and BNB?

REZ functions specifically as a Liquid Restaking Token and Strategy Manager for EigenLayer, offering yields potentially higher than traditional ETH staking through its specialized restaking mechanism—a relatively new innovation in the DeFi landscape introduced in 2024. BNB serves as the native utility token for the Binance ecosystem, providing broader functionality including transaction fee discounts, participation in token sales, and integration across Binance's comprehensive exchange infrastructure established since 2017. While REZ targets a niche within liquid staking protocols, BNB benefits from integration within one of the world's largest cryptocurrency exchanges, offering substantially wider use cases and institutional adoption despite operating in different technical domains.

Q5: What regulatory risks distinguish REZ from BNB investments?

Both assets face regulatory uncertainty, but through different lenses: BNB, as an exchange-native token tied directly to Binance's operations, may encounter scrutiny related to centralized exchange regulations, securities classifications, and compliance requirements across multiple jurisdictions where Binance operates. REZ faces regulatory considerations specific to liquid staking protocols and DeFi applications, including potential classification questions around staking derivatives and the regulatory treatment of restaking mechanisms within the EigenLayer framework. Global regulatory developments could impact these assets asymmetrically—exchange tokens might face stricter operational requirements, while DeFi protocols could encounter challenges related to decentralization claims and securities law interpretations, making diversification across both categories potentially valuable for regulatory risk mitigation.
